31 lines
809 B
Modula-2
31 lines
809 B
Modula-2
|
NAME DdeSpy
|
||
|
|
||
|
EXETYPE WINDOWS ; required for all Windows applications
|
||
|
|
||
|
STUB 'WINSTUB.EXE' ; Generates error message if application
|
||
|
; is run without Windows
|
||
|
|
||
|
;CODE can be moved in memory and discarded/reloaded
|
||
|
CODE PRELOAD MOVEABLE DISCARDABLE
|
||
|
|
||
|
;DATA must be MULTIPLE if program can be invoked more than once
|
||
|
DATA PRELOAD MOVEABLE MULTIPLE
|
||
|
|
||
|
|
||
|
HEAPSIZE 4096
|
||
|
STACKSIZE 5120 ; recommended minimum for Windows applications
|
||
|
|
||
|
|
||
|
; All functions that will be called by any Windows routine
|
||
|
; MUST be exported.
|
||
|
|
||
|
EXPORTS
|
||
|
MainWndProc @1 ; name of window processing function
|
||
|
About @2 ; name of "About" processing function
|
||
|
OpenDlg @3
|
||
|
StrWndProc @4
|
||
|
DdeCallback @5
|
||
|
MarkDlgProc @6
|
||
|
MCLBClientWndProc @7
|
||
|
FilterDlgProc @8
|